Cohiba Cuban Cuisine
Inspectors have visited Cohiba Cuban Cuisine eight times, with records going back to 2014. Cohiba Cuban Cuisine was last inspected on Jan 19, 2018. A low risk tier reflects an inspection that turned up minimal issues. No fresh inspection data is available: the latest entry for Cohiba Cuban Cuisine dates to Jan 19, 2018.
Things are looking better lately, with recent visits averaging around three violations compared to roughly seven violations earlier on.
“Food and non-food contact surfaces properly designed” comes up most often, recorded four times in the inspection record.
Compared to other Chicago restaurants (averaging 81), there's room to close the gap. Taken together, the history is a positive one.
